搭建QT和VS2010集成开发环境
轉(zhuǎn)載請注明出處:http://blog.csdn.net/xiaowei_cqu/article/details/7330759
在網(wǎng)上搜了各種教程,(尤其是這篇各種轉(zhuǎn)載http://tech.techweb.com.cn/thread-465252-1-1.html)
都是要下載sdk再用vs10把源碼編譯一遍……
試了一下午,各種“qmake failed……” 、“cannot find file……”、“perl not found in environment”等錯誤
感覺同學(xué)遇到的沒遇到的錯誤被我遇到了,有的按照教程之類的解決了,有的實在糾結(jié),最終還是faile了。
估計原因,大概一是安裝了太多遍(在下次安裝時要選上刪除原版本),二是環(huán)境變量之類的問題,三就是中文目錄的問題。(注意win7中有時候tmp的目錄也是含有中文的,因為不是users而是[用戶]的中文,這里可以在系統(tǒng)環(huán)境變量里把temp改成C:\temp之類的)。
最終還是放棄了網(wǎng)上各種版本的教程,到官網(wǎng)仔細(xì)把說明又看了一遍。
注意sdk有online和offline安裝的版本,offline有1.3G,是開發(fā)套件,安裝時會把qt creator和源碼都裝上。
如果不是特別有必要的話,只安裝qt libraries就可以。
要配置vs與qt的集成開發(fā)環(huán)境,就選擇用vs10編譯的qt庫。
之前qt的源碼都是默認(rèn)用minGW編譯的,所以網(wǎng)上的教程才是用vs10的編譯器重新編譯一遍,現(xiàn)在既然有vs編譯的版本,直接安裝就可以啦~
安裝之后將qt的bin目錄添加到系統(tǒng)環(huán)境變量中。
再安裝一個vs10的插件qt-vs-addin-1.1.1
打開Visual Studio2010,就可以創(chuàng)建qt的工程啦~
總結(jié)
以上是生活随笔為你收集整理的搭建QT和VS2010集成开发环境的全部內(nèi)容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 数据降维方法分类
- 下一篇: C++和MATLAB混合编程-DLL篇